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Seaforth & Litherland to Rotherhithe start from as little as £43.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Seaforth & Litherland to Rotherhithe start from £79.80 one way, or £114.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Seaforth & Litherland to Rotherhithe are available for £201.60 one way, or £403.20 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ities at Seaforth & Litherland

The station provides essential facilities to ensure passengers have a smooth and comfortable journey. The ticket office operates from early morning till midnight on weekdays and weekends, although ticket machines are not available. However, tickets purchased online can easily be collected from the ticket office. Accessibility is prioritized here with step-free access throughout, and ramps are available for train access. Unfortunately, despite full station access, there aren't any accessible ticket machines or toilets, although assistance can be requested via the Passenger Assist service.

For those traveling by car, the station offers a free car park with 48 spaces, including 5 dedicated to accessible parking. Cycling enthusiasts can also benefit from 34 bicycle storage spaces. Though there are no shops or refreshment areas at the station, Seaforth & Litherland ensures a secure environment with CCTV monitoring across the station.

Onward Travel Options

Connecting with other transport modes is straightforward. Although there's no direct taxi rank, the nearby bus services ensure seamless travel to your next destination. For precise bus routes or schedules, passengers can visit Merseytravel or contact Traveline. Additionally, for travelers needing to catch a flight, Liverpool John Lennon Airport is accessible from Liverpool South Parkway station via the 86A or 80A bus, with tickets available that cover both train and bus segments.

The station also accommodates rail replacement services, with pick-up points at Seaforth Road, making it easy during planned maintenance or unexpected disruptions.

Station Facilities and Amenities

At Rotherhithe Station, passengers have access to necessary ticket purchasing and collection facilities. With ticket machines available along with the capability to collect tickets bought online, your travel plans can continue without a hitch. The ticket office is operational from 07:30 to 10:00 from Monday to Friday. For those who require additional assistance, step-free access is available, except for a few steps from the foot of the escalator to platform level.

While the station doesn’t boast extensive amenities like a waiting room or refreshment facilities, it ensures basic needs with the availability of smartcard validators and induction loops for accessibility. However, travelers should note the absence of luggage storage and accessible toilets. The station is equipped with CCTV for safety and a modest bicycle storage area for cyclists.

Onward Travel Options

Rotherhithe Station connects well with other transport networks that facilitate swift movement across London. Rail replacement services link to various parts of the city, with bus stop Y catering to southbound travels to New Cross and bus stop D at Canada Water bus station handling northbound services towards Dalston.

If you wish to journey via the Jubilee Line, Canada Water is just one stop south—making the Underground easily accessible. Moreover, those flying in or out of London have easy access to London City Airport through connections available at Shadwell via the Docklands Light Railway.
